Understanding Your Audience: Who Needs Restoration Services?

Before diving into marketing strategies, it’s crucial to understand your audience. Who needs restoration services?

  • Homeowners: After a flood, fire, or storm, homeowners need fast, reliable restoration services.
  • Businesses: Offices, restaurants, and other commercial properties also face damage and require restoration experts.
  • Insurance Companies: Many restoration jobs come through referrals from insurance companies, making it vital to build strong relationships with them.

The Power of Digital Marketing in the Restoration Industry

1. Search Engine Optimization (SEO): Be Found When It Matters Most

Imagine a homeowner whose basement just flooded. They won’t spend hours researching— they’ll Google “emergency water damage restoration near me” and call the first reputable company they find.

That’s why SEO is crucial. By optimizing your website with relevant keywords, local listings, and quality content, you increase your chances of appearing in top search results when potential customers need you the most. 2. Pay-Per-Click (PPC) Advertising: Instant Visibility

SEO is essential, but it takes time to show results. If you want instant visibility, PPC advertising is the answer. With Google Ads, you can target specific keywords like:

  • “Emergency flood restoration near me”
  • “Smoke damage cleanup services”
  • “Mold removal experts”

Since these ads appear at the top of search results, they can drive immediate leads to your business.

3. Social Media Marketing: Build Trust and Authority

You might think social media isn’t necessary for restoration businesses, but that’s far from the truth. Platforms like Facebook, Instagram, and LinkedIn help build trust and engage with potential clients.

Consider posting:

  • Before-and-after photos of restoration projects
  • Customer testimonials to showcase your reliability
  • Tips on preventing water or fire damage to position yourself as an expert

The more visible and trustworthy you appear, the more likely customers will choose your services when disaster strikes.

4. Content Marketing: Educate and Engage Your Audience

Let’s face it—most people don’t think about restoration services until they desperately need them. But what if you could stay on their radar before disaster strikes?

That’s where content marketing comes in. Writing blog posts, creating videos, or offering free resources (like “What to Do After a House Fire”) keeps your business top-of-mind. When people need restoration services, they’ll remember the company that provided them with valuable information.

5. Email Marketing: Stay Connected with Clients and Partners

Did you know that repeat customers and referrals play a huge role in the restoration industry? That’s why email marketing is an effective tool to maintain connections with past clients, insurance companies, and property managers.

Send:

  • Follow-up emails after a service, checking if clients need further assistance
  • Seasonal tips, like “How to Prevent Frozen Pipes This Winter”
  • Special offers for returning customers

Keeping in touch ensures your business remains top-of-mind when future needs arise.

The Importance of Reputation Management

Would you trust a restoration company with bad reviews? Neither would your potential clients.

Online reputation is everything. Encouraging satisfied customers to leave positive reviews on Google, Yelp, and Facebook can boost your credibility. Additionally, responding to negative reviews professionally shows potential clients that you care about customer service.

Local Marketing: Strengthen Your Presence in the Community

Restoration businesses rely heavily on local customers. That’s why local marketing strategies are essential:

  • Google My Business (GMB) Optimization: A well-optimized GMB profile increases your chances of showing up in local searches.
  • Local Partnerships: Collaborate with insurance agents, real estate professionals, and property managers for referrals.
  • Community Involvement: Sponsor local events, offer free safety workshops, or partner with disaster relief organizations to build trust in your community.

Traditional Marketing Still Works!

While digital marketing is powerful, don’t ignore traditional methods:

  • Direct mail campaigns targeting homeowners and businesses
  • Billboards and vehicle wraps to increase brand visibility
  • Networking events with insurance agents and property managers

A combination of digital and traditional marketing creates a well-rounded strategy that maximizes growth opportunities.
